The Importance of Financial Literacy in Modern Society

Financial literacy is the ability to understand and manage personal finances effectively. It includes budgeting, saving, investing, debt management, and financial planning. In today’s economy, financial literacy has become increasingly important as individuals face rising living costs, complex financial products, and growing economic uncertainty.

One of the key benefits of financial literacy is improved money management. Individuals who understand budgeting and saving strategies are better prepared to handle emergencies and achieve long-term financial goals. Financial education also helps consumers avoid excessive debt and make informed decisions regarding loans, mortgages, and investments.

Many young adults struggle with financial management due to limited education about personal finance. Schools and educational institutions are increasingly recognizing the importance of teaching financial literacy to students. Topics such as credit scores, retirement planning, taxes, and responsible spending habits can help individuals build stronger financial futures.

Technology has made financial management more accessible through mobile banking apps, investment platforms, and budgeting tools. Consumers can now monitor expenses, transfer money, and manage savings directly from smartphones. However, financial scams and online fraud continue increasing, making financial awareness even more essential.

Experts emphasize that financial literacy contributes to economic stability and personal independence. Individuals who develop strong financial habits are more likely to achieve financial security and avoid long-term economic hardship.
